Hey guys! Haven't posted in quite a while. Anyway...been looking at knives for camping lately, and I am not entirely sure what I am looking for. My wife and I do a camping trip every year for our anniversary, and I've been looking at getting a new knife to take with me.

My wife likes my BK2...she likes that its basically a small tank in her hand haha. I have been carrying my ZT0100 on these trips, and its been great, but the sheath is less than ideal, and I have been having a hard time finding sheaths for it online (guess I dont really know what I am looking for there, either). Plus, while I love the recurve, I find its not the best for some things when camping, and I tend to grab the BK2 for a lot of stuff. We both EDC ZT0350s. I also have a Gerber Big Rock, which is not super great, that I just keep in the car.

I've owned a few TOPS knives in the past (CAT, Interceptor, Steel Eagle) and a Maniord Karambit (which is obviously no good for camping, plus that guy ripped me off for $300 on a custom knife).

Recently bought a couple Swamp Rats...Rodent 3, Solution, and Ratmandu. The Rodent 3 is too small for me to do anything with. The tiny handle is just too small for me. The Solution is a great size, but the handle is too thin, and my hand cramps up trying to use it.

Ratmandu just shipped today, so I am hoping that does the job for me, but if not, what else should I be looking at? Not entirely sure what I need in terms of blade length, but I was thinking around 4-5 inches...maybe 5 is too big? I dunno.

Also, was considering the Becker BK16, but I really don't like that crappy grivory material they use on their handles...and I know the micarta scales are around, but thats more money...

I was also looking at some Swamp Rat HRLMs on ebay, but I don't know if I want to pay what people are asking for them.

Trying to keep price at $200 or less, but could go to $250 or so if something is really worth it. Really just hoping the RMD works for me. Thanks!
